Sure, I'd be happy to provide you with a tutorial on creating a partition function for the Quicksort algorithm in Python. Quicksort is a popular sorting algorithm that works by partitioning an array into two sub-arrays and then recursively sorting the sub-arrays.
Let's start by understanding the partition function. The partition function is responsible for selecting a pivot element and rearranging the array elements in such a way that elements smaller than the pivot are on its left, and elements greater than the pivot are on its right.
Here's a step-by-step guide along with a Python code example:
Quicksort is a divide-and-conquer algorithm. The basic idea is to select a pivot element from the array and partition the other elements into two sub-arrays, according to whether they are less than or greater than the pivot. The sub-arrays are then sorted recursively.
